The Early Life and Rise of Pee-wee Herman
Before we delve into Paul Reubens' net worth, let's take a quick trip down memory lane. Born on August 27, 1952, in New York City, Paul Reubens (born Paul Rubenfeld) had a passion for entertainment from an early age. He attended the California Institute of the Arts, where he honed his comedic chops and developed the iconic character of Pee-wee Herman.
His big break came in the early 1980s when he started performing his Pee-wee Herman show at the Groundlings Theatre in Los Angeles. The quirky, family-friendly humor resonated with audiences, and soon enough, Paul found himself on the path to fame and fortune.
The Pee-wee Phenomenon and Paul's Rising Net Worth
The success of Pee-wee Herman led to a string of lucrative opportunities for Paul Reubens. Here's a quick rundown of how Pee-wee helped boost Paul's net worth:
Pee-wee's Playhouse (1986-1991)
The beloved children's television show, Pee-wee's Playhouse, aired on CBS from 1986 to 1991. Paul served as the show's creator, executive producer, and star. The show's immense popularity translated into big bucks for Paul, with each episode reportedly earning him around $30,000.
Pee-wee's Big Adventure (1985)
Paul's net worth also got a significant boost from the 1985 film Pee-wee's Big Adventure. The movie was a massive success, grossing over $40 million at the box office. Although the exact earnings from the film are unknown, it undoubtedly contributed to Paul's growing wealth.
Endorsements and Merchandise
The Pee-wee Herman phenomenon also spawned various merchandise and endorsement deals, further padding Paul's net worth. From toys and clothing to breakfast cereals and video games, Pee-wee was everywhere in the '80s and '90s.

Paul Reubens' Legal Troubles and Their Impact on His Net Worth
While Paul Reubens' career has been marked by success and creativity, it's also seen its share of controversy. In 1991, Paul was arrested for indecent exposure at an adult theater in Florida. The arrest led to a media frenzy and ultimately caused the cancellation of Pee-wee's Playhouse.
The scandal undoubtedly had an impact on Paul's net worth, as it led to a decline in his popularity and the loss of various endorsement deals. However, Paul managed to bounce back from the scandal and continue his career in Hollywood.
